Proposed Development

for development. The development will consist of (i) the installation of one new façade sign on the North Elevation comprising backlit individually mounted stainless steel lettering with associated backlit circular logo at high level (ii) one new façade sign on the West Elevation comprising backlit individually mounted stainless steel lettering with associated backlit circular logo at high level (iii) The repositioning of one existing backlit stainless steel sign
